You probably didn’t notice but this is the second member of the Waterfall family! The first one was in “The Problem with Popplers” which was Free Waterfall Jr. This episode being his father, Free Waterfall Sr. Each episode one appears in they die at the end (one of my favorite running gags on this show) so be sure to keep a look out for other members of the Waterfall family in future episodes!

It is a joke, but reality is that there is real temperature (where absolute zero is absolute).. but then there is perceived temperature (based on how hard it would be for us humans to endure the temperature) where wind, and air humidity will affect how cold it actually "feels" (We don't have an actual thermometer sensor in our body, we just feel how quickly we lose heat).. so.. yeah.. Absolute Zero without wind should take our body temperature away much slower than absolute zero in gale force wind, so.. below absolute zero does at least.. "make sense" from the narrative... Of course it wouldn't matter as we'd be dead either way.
